vb 求高手帮我解释一下这段编码

来自:    更新日期:早些时候
高手来看看关于VB编程中的一段代码,帮忙解释一下~

On Error Resume Next '如果出错,就忽略,直接运行下一句
Dim APP1() As Byte '定义可变数组,类型为Byte
If Dir(App.Path & "\文件名.exe") = "" Then '如果当前路径下没有“文件名.exe”,那么
APP1 = LoadResData(101, "CUSTOM") '调用资源文件中的CUSTOM,赋值给数组APP1
Open App.Path & "\文件名.exe" For Binary As #2 '在当前路径下新建文件名.exe
Put #2, , APP1 '把APP1的内容写入这个文件
Close #2 '关闭这个文件
End If '结束判断
Shell "文件名.exe", vbHide '以隐藏窗口方式运行这个文件

在Print secproc(c,b,a)里,先调用了firproc(a,c,b)
即fireproc(3,5,4),即2*3+5+3,返回的是14,
然后运算15+c+7,c是5,secproc返回26

即,最后输出26

不过,firproc里虽然有参数z,但却没有用到z,不知道2*x+y+3是不是楼主z*x+y+3的误录。如果是这种误录的话,结果就是32了

利用循环、tab和空格来控制打印*号。
print后跟分号表示不换行,没有分号的打印完本行后自动换行。


vb 求高手帮我解释一下这段编码视频

相关评论:

相关主题精彩

版权声明:本网站为非赢利性站点,内容来自于网络投稿和网络,若有相关事宜,请联系管理员

Copyright © 喜物网